Stricter Rules for Alcohol Sales in Tamil Nadu
The Tamil Nadu government has taken a tougher approach toward alcohol sales and access, especially among younger citizens. According to recent developments, liquor shops have been directed to verify the age of customers more strictly. Anyone below the legal age will not be allowed to buy alcohol, and in cases of doubt, identity documents such as Aadhaar cards may be checked.
The move is aimed at reducing underage drinking and ensuring that alcohol does not become easily accessible to teenagers and young adults.

No Alcohol for People Below 21
Reports indicate that the government is reinforcing the rule that people below 21 years of age cannot legally purchase alcohol in Tamil Nadu. Officials have instructed liquor outlets to strictly follow this policy.
This means that customers may now face more verification at shops before purchasing alcohol.
717 Liquor Shops Ordered to Shut
One of the biggest decisions taken by Chief Minister Vijay after assuming office was the closure of hundreds of government-operated liquor outlets.
The Tamil Nadu government ordered the closure of 717 TASMAC liquor shops located within 500 meters of schools, colleges, temples, places of worship, and bus stations. According to the government, the decision was taken keeping public welfare in mind.
Officials believe that reducing the presence of liquor shops around sensitive public places can help create a safer environment for students and families.
Possible Changes in Shop Timings
There are also discussions about reducing the operating hours of liquor outlets. Reports suggest that the government is considering earlier closing times for liquor shops compared to the current schedule. However, final implementation details are still under discussion.
A Bigger Social Vision?
The recent alcohol-related decisions indicate that the Vijay government may be trying to gradually reduce alcohol dependence and promote a healthier social environment.
Though Tamil Nadu earns a significant amount of revenue from alcohol sales, the administration appears to be balancing revenue concerns with public welfare priorities.
